About this carrier

LOIGNON CHAMP-CARR INC is a Saint Come Liniere, PQ freight carrier that is authorized for property in the state of Québec. This company has 65 truck(s) in their fleet and 65 truck drivers. Their motor carrier number is MC-379692 and their USDOT number is 265151.
